Exercise 4.4. It is known that in a company, the average time required to process invoices is 8 days with a standard deviation of 36 hours. If the processing time is normally distributed, what proportion of the invoices is processed between 6 and 11 days? Exercise 4.5. Assuming that the White Blood Cell (WBC) count per cubic millimeter of whole blood is normally distributed with a mean of 6800 and a standard deviation of 1550. The lowest 5% of all WBC counts is defined to be probable at risk. How low must one's WBC count be to fall in the at risk group?
